Gloria (Ferullo) Sama, formerly of Watertown, passed away on April 21, 2021 after a short illness. She was 89 years old. Beloved wife of the late Gerald Sama. Loving mother of Lisa Sama of Westford and Judy Sama of Framingham. She is also survived by four grandchildren: Alessandra Forcucci, Andrew Gramigna, Matthew Gramigna and Anastasia Forcucci, and is survived by Lisa's husband John Forcucci of Westford, Judy's partner Eric Peltonen of Framingham, and former son-in- law Gary Gramigna. Born in the North End across the street from the Paul Revere House, Gloria was the first person in her immediate family born in the United States. She was predeceased by her sisters Teresa and Melinda, and brothers Anthony and Giovanni. She is also survived by many nieces and nephews. While living in Watertown, Gloria was an active member of Saint Patrick Church and a Eucharistic Minister in the community. Donations in her memory can be made to Saint Patrick Church in Watertown. Family and friends are welcome to Celebrate Gloria's Life with a Funeral Mass on Saturday, June 19 at 12 Noon in St. Patrick's Church. Arrangements made by the Nardone Funeral Home, 373 Main St. Watertown, MA 02472.
